Dacia appoints Miles Nürnberger as design director

Long-time Aston Martin designer Miles Nürnberger leaves to head up Dacia

Miles Nürnberger is set to take the design director role at the Dacia & LADA Business Unit starting 1 September, 2021. He will also join its management committee, and will report to Laurens van den Acker, executive vice president of corporate design and member of the board of management of Renault Group.

“We are very pleased to welcome Miles Nürnberger into our team at such an exciting time for the Dacia brand,” commented van den Acker. “Miles is a renowned designer who has inspired many with his work at Aston Martin. His experience and passion for building strong brands through design will be a great asset for Dacia and help us project Dacia into the future.”

Nürnberger spent over 13 years at Aston Martin, climbing his way up from design manager when he started in 2008 to director of design in 2018. He worked several key models for the brand, including the DB11 and DBX. Nürnberger also held roles at Citroen and Ford, and is a graduate of Coventry University.

The news of Nürnberger’s appointment comes soon after Alejandro Mesonero-Romanos left the role having been in it for just eight months, opting instead for a new job at Alfa Romeo.
